WebInstantaneous velocity is the first derivative of displacement with respect to time. Speed and velocity are related in much the same way that distance and displacement are related. Speed is a scalar and velocity is a vector. Speed gets the symbol v (italic) and velocity gets the symbol v (boldface). Average values get a bar over the symbol. WebNov 2, 2024 · Velocity is defined as the measuring of displacement over a period of time.-> Velocity = change in displacement/change in time, it's unit is in metre per second. Speed is a scalar quantity while velocity is a vector quantity. Two objects or bodies can have the same speed but different velocities when they move in a different direction.

WebYour notion of velocity is probably similar to its scientific definition. You know that a large displacement in a small amount of time means a large velocity and that velocity has units of distance divided by time, such as miles per hour or kilometers per hour.
